Start Early

You should not wait until you finish high school to begin looking for a scholarship. That is because if you wait for quite long, the colleges may have already signed players they want. It is advisable to start early. In this way, you can increase your chances of winning the scholarship. Moreover, you will have an opportunity to fix issues that can hinder you from getting the scholarship. Make sure you have a list of colleges that offer sports scholarships and choose those you want.

Seek Professional Assessment

sportsThe truth is that the local coach can be a valuable resource. That is because the coach can reveal a lot regarding your athletic abilities. However, your coach may not the right person to assess your talent. You may need to spend extra money by seeking a professional sports assessment. The good thing about this is that you will get a lot of valuable information that can help you in your future sporting endeavors. For instance, you will discover both your strengths and weaknesses. Moreover, you can get guidance on the type of sports scholarship you should seek.

Research Eligibility Rules

There are different organizations that offer sports scholarships depending on your state. Every organization has rules that you must adhere to for you to qualify. For instance, you may be required to complete a certain number of lessons. Moreover, you need to attain certain grades to qualify.

Increase Listening Speed

home learningOne of the great things about audiobooks is that you can usually adjust the playback speed to suit your needs. If you’re trying to get through a book quickly, you can increase the playback speed and still understand what’s happening. This can be helpful if you’re trying to fit a book into a busy schedule. Just be sure not to increase the playback speed too much, as it can start to sound like a chipmunk and be challenging to understand.

Stay Focused

It can be easy to get distracted when listening to an audiobook, especially if you’re doing other things simultaneously. One way to stay focused is to close your eyes and picture the scene described in your mind. This will help you pay attention to the words and follow along with the story. You can also find a quiet place to listen to your audiobook, so you’re not competing with other noises.

Choose Something You Like

There are so many different audiobooks available that it can be hard to choose one. If you’re unsure where to start, try picking something that you’re interested in or similar to something you’ve read before. You can also look for recommendations from friends or family members. Once you find an audiobook you like, you’ll be hooked!

Use Rewind Button With Discretion

classroomsThe rewind button can be your best friend or worst enemy when listening to an audiobook. If you miss something or want to hear something again, it can be tempting to hit the rewind button repeatedly.

However, this can make it challenging to stay focused on the story. Use the rewind button sparingly and only when you need to.
